Topics Covered
- 1. Fundamentals of Parenteral Formulations: Learners will study the basic principles of parenteral formulations, including types of parenteral dosage forms and their applications. They will gain an understanding of the physical and chemical properties of drugs suitable for parenteral administration.
- 2. Parenteral Drug Stability: This module covers the factors affecting the stability of parenteral drugs, including temperature, light, and pH, and techniques to enhance stability.
- 3. Advanced Formulation Techniques: Learners will explore advanced techniques in parenteral formulation, such as sterile filtration, lyophilization, and colloidal systems, and how to optimize these techniques for specific drug formulations.
- 4. Quality Control in Parenteral Formulations: This module focuses on the quality control measures and analytical methods used to ensure the safety and efficacy of parenteral products, including sterility testing and pyrogen testing.
- 5. Packaging Systems for Parenteral Products: Learners will study various packaging materials and systems used in parenteral product packaging, their impact on drug stability, and how to select the appropriate packaging for different formulations.
- 6. Regulatory Requirements for Parenteral Products: This module covers the regulatory guidelines and standards for parenteral formulations, including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and regulatory submissions.
- 7. Risk Management in Parenteral Formulations: Learners will learn about risk management strategies for parenteral formulations, including identification, assessment, and mitigation of potential risks in the development and production process.
- 8. Case Studies in Parenteral Formulation and Packaging: Through real-world case studies, learners will analyze and discuss challenges and solutions in the formulation and packaging of parenteral products, enhancing their problem-solving skills.
- 9. Emerging Trends in Parenteral Formulations: This module explores the latest advancements and emerging trends in parenteral formulations, such as nanoparticles and targeted delivery systems, and their implications for the industry.
- 10. Leadership and Strategic Thinking in Pharmaceutical Management: Learners will develop leadership skills and strategic thinking necessary for managing a pharmaceutical company, focusing on decision-making and planning in the context of parenteral formulation development.
